South Side: A Limon Tradition
South Side Restaurant & Bar has been a Limon, Colorado staple for more than 50 years. Founded in 1972, South Side originally stood on 1st & E Ave., across from the historic railroad depot, serving the community as a pool hall and bar until it was destroyed by a tornado in 1990. Rebuilt in its current location in 1991, South Side has remained a local favorite for generations.
In 2025, South Side was fully renovated, refreshing its eclectic, nostalgic character while preserving the pieces that tell its story. Among them are the original 100+ year-old back bar and pool hall pieces dating back more than 145 years, along with the artwork, mirrors, and neons collected through the years- a connection to the past that remains part of South Side today.
